
然而,在某些情况下,我们可能需要将其从系统中完全卸载,比如更换数据库软件、系统重装或解决一些难以解决的兼容性问题
卸载MySQL并不是简单的删除文件或程序那么简单,它涉及到多个层面的操作,以确保系统的稳定性和数据的完整性
接下来,我们将详细介绍如何彻底删除MySQL安装,以确保卸载过程干净且不会留下任何残留
一、准备工作 在卸载MySQL之前,我们需要做一些准备工作,以确保卸载过程顺利进行
1.备份数据: - 如果MySQL中存储有重要数据,务必在卸载之前进行备份
- 可以使用MySQL自带的备份工具(如mysqldump)或第三方备份软件进行数据备份
2.停止MySQL服务: - 在卸载MySQL之前,必须停止MySQL服务,以避免数据损坏或服务冲突
- 可以通过任务管理器或命令行工具(如sc stop mysql服务名)来停止MySQL服务
二、卸载MySQL程序 卸载MySQL程序是卸载过程的第一步,可以通过控制面板或命令行来进行
1.通过控制面板卸载: - 打开控制面板,选择“程序和功能”
- 在程序列表中找到MySQL相关的程序(如MySQL Server、MySQL Workbench等),右键点击并选择“卸载”
- 按照卸载向导的提示完成卸载过程
2.通过命令行卸载: - 打开命令提示符(以管理员身份运行)
- 使用`MsiExec.exe /x{ProductCode}`命令来卸载MySQL程序,其中`{ProductCode}`是MySQL安装包的唯一标识符
- 注意:这种方法需要知道MySQL安装包的ProductCode,可以通过注册表或使用第三方软件来查找
三、删除MySQL安装目录和数据目录 卸载程序后,还需要手动删除MySQL的安装目录和数据目录,以确保没有残留文件
1.删除安装目录: - 默认情况下,MySQL的安装目录位于`C:Program FilesMySQL`或`C:Program Files(x86)MySQL`
- 打开这些目录,并删除与MySQL相关的所有文件夹和文件
2.删除数据目录: - MySQL的数据目录通常位于`C:ProgramDataMySQL`(隐藏文件夹,需要显示隐藏文件才能看到)
- 打开该目录,并删除与MySQL相关的所有文件夹和文件
注意:数据目录中包含的是MySQL数据库的实际数据文件,因此在删除之前务必确认已经备份了重要数据
四、清理注册表残留项 MySQL在安装过程中会在注册表中写入一些配置信息,卸载程序后这些残留项需要手动清理
1.打开注册表编辑器: - 按`Win+R`键打开运行对话框,输入`regedit`并按回车打开注册表编辑器
2.搜索并删除MySQL相关项: - 在注册表编辑器中,按照以下路径搜索并删除与MySQL相关的项: t -`HKEY_LOCAL_MACHINESOFTWAREMySQL` t -`HKEY_LOCAL_MACHINESYSTEMControlSet001ServicesEventlogApplicationMySQL` t -`HKEY_LOCAL_MACHINESYSTEMControlSet002ServicesEventlogApplicationMySQL`(如果存在多个ControlSet00x,都需要检查并删除) t -`H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esEventlogApplicationMySQL` - 注意:在删除注册表项之前,建议先备份注册表,以防止误删除导致系统问题
五、删除MySQL服务 如果MySQL服务在卸载过程中没有被自动删除,我们需要手动删除它
1.打开命令提示符(以管理员身份运行)
2. 输入`sc delete mysql服务名`命令来删除MySQL服务
其中`mysql服务名`是MySQL服务的实际名称,可以通过服务管理器或命令行工具(如`sc query state= all | find SERVICE_NAME`)来查找
六、删除环境变量配置(如有) 如果在安装MySQL时配置了环境变量,我们还需要手动删除这些配置
1.右键点击“此电脑”或“计算机”,选择“属性”
2. 点击“高级系统设置”,然后点击“环境变量”
3. 在系统变量中找到`Path`变量,点击“编辑”
4. 在变量值中找到与MySQL相关的路径(如MySQL的bin目录路径),选中并删除它
5. 点击“确定”保存更改
七、验证卸载是否彻底 完成以上步骤后,我们需要验证MySQL是否已经被彻底卸载
1.检查安装目录和数据目录: - 确保`C:Program FilesMySQL`、`C:Program Files(x86)MySQL`和`C:ProgramDataMySQL`等目录已经被完全删除
2.检查注册表: - 使用注册表编辑器搜索`MySQL`关键字,确保没有残留的MySQL相关项
3.检查服务管理器: - 打开服务管理器,检查是否有MySQL相关的服务存在
4.尝试重新安装MySQL: - 如果以上步骤都确认无误,可以尝试重新安装MySQL来验证卸载是否彻底
如果重新安装过程中没有出现任何冲突或错误提示,说明MySQL已经被彻底卸载
八、总结与注意事项 卸载MySQL是一个涉及多个层面的复杂过程,需要仔细操作以确保卸载的彻底性和系统的稳定性
在卸载过程中,务必注意以下几点: -备份数据:在卸载之前务必备份重要数据,以防止数据丢失
-停止服务:在卸载之前必须停止MySQL服务,以避免数据损坏或服务冲突
-手动删除残留文件:卸载程序后需要手动删除MySQL的安装目录和数据目录以及注册表残留项和环境变量配置等
-验证卸载是否彻底:完成卸载后需要仔细检查安装目录、注册表、服务管理器等地方以确保卸载的彻底性
通过以上步骤的详细介绍和实践操作,我们可以成功地彻底删除MySQL安装并确保系统的干净和稳定
希望这篇文章能对需要卸载MySQL的读者有所帮助
YUM安装MySQL57教程指南
如何彻底卸载MySQL安装:详细步骤指南
MySQL项目访问故障排查指南
MySQL实战指南:阿里技术解析
PyLucene与MySQL集成应用指南
MySQL空值处理,默认设为0技巧
MySQL触发器:误操作风险,勿用于删除数据库
YUM安装MySQL57教程指南
DBA指南:如何为数据库加装MySQL
MySQL数据解压与删除技巧指南
快速指南:如何在CMD中打开MySQL
MySQL SQL技巧:如何实现数据降序排列?
升级MYSQL后,如何应对索引丢失
MySQL卸载教程:轻松告别数据库
如何在MySQL中停用外键约束:详细操作步骤
MySQL:如何高效kill LOAD DATA进程
MySQL安装失败?彻底卸载指南
如何设置MySQL终端远程访问权限
MySQL数据库:如何增加一个分区